Introduction to Cracked Fiber Cement Siding
Fiber cement siding is a popular building material made from a mixture of cement, sand, and cellulose fibers. It is known for its durability, low maintenance, and resistance to rot and pests.
Cracks in fiber cement siding can occur due to various reasons such as improper installation, impact from hail or debris, moisture infiltration, or natural expansion and contraction. These cracks can compromise the integrity of the siding and lead to water intrusion, which can cause further damage to the building structure.
Implications of Cracked Fiber Cement Siding
Cracked fiber cement siding can result in water seeping into the walls, leading to mold growth, rotting of the underlying structure, and potential structural issues. It can also impact the insulation of the building, reducing energy efficiency and increasing heating and cooling costs. Therefore, it is essential to address cracked fiber cement siding promptly to prevent further damage and maintain the structural integrity of the building.

Visible Signs of Cracked Fiber Cement Siding
- Visible cracks on the surface of the siding
- Peeling or bubbling paint on the siding
- Warped or distorted siding panels
- Mold or mildew growth on the siding
Impact of Weather Conditions on Cracks
Weather conditions such as extreme heat, cold, or humidity can exacerbate cracks in fiber cement siding. The expansion and contraction of the material due to temperature fluctuations can cause existing cracks to widen or new cracks to form.
Identifying Cracked Fiber Cement Siding
Homeowners can identify cracked fiber cement siding by conducting a visual inspection of their property. Look for any visible cracks, peeling paint, warping, or signs of moisture damage on the siding. Additionally, tapping on the siding panels can help determine if there are any hollow or damaged areas that indicate cracks.

Repairing Minor Cracks in Fiber Cement Siding
When dealing with minor cracks in fiber cement siding, follow these steps:
- Begin by cleaning the area around the crack to remove any dirt or debris.
- Apply a high-quality exterior caulk to fill in the crack, ensuring it is smooth and evenly distributed.
- Allow the caulk to dry completely before painting over it to match the rest of the siding.
Seeking Professional Help for Cracked Fiber Cement Siding
If you notice extensive cracking or damage to your fiber cement siding, it is best to seek professional help. A qualified contractor will be able to assess the severity of the damage and recommend the best course of action, whether it involves repairs or replacement of the siding.
Maintaining Fiber Cement Siding to Prevent Cracks
To prevent cracks in fiber cement siding, consider the following maintenance tips:
- Regularly inspect the siding for any signs of damage, such as cracks or chips.
- Keep the siding clean by washing it with a mild detergent and water to remove dirt and debris.
- Ensure proper installation of the siding, with adequate clearance from the ground and other surfaces to prevent moisture buildup.
- Repaint the siding every few years to maintain its protective coating and prevent water damage.

Proper Installation Techniques
Proper installation of fiber cement siding is essential in preventing cracks. Hiring experienced professionals who follow manufacturer guidelines and best practices can significantly reduce the likelihood of cracks developing. Ensuring that the siding is installed correctly, with adequate spacing and fastening, can help maintain its structural integrity over time.
